2001 Region: Yorkshire - Championship Section

Date:
Sunday, March 4, 2001

Venue:
St George’s Hall, Bradford

Test piece:
Jazz, Philip Wilby

Adjudicator(s):
Steve Sykes

Pos Band Conductor Dr Pts
1Black DykeN. Childs5193
2Yorkshire Building SocietyD. King7192
3Brighouse and RatsrickA. Withington 8190
4Grimethorpe Colliery RJBG. Cutt2188
5ntl SkelmanthorpeK. Wadsworth12187
6Todmorden OldD. Hadfield11186
7DUT Yorkshire Imperial RothwellT. Wyss9185
8Rothwell TemperanceD. Roberts3184
9HepworthA. Duncan10183
10Carlton Main Frickley CollieryJ. Hinckley4182
11Yorkshire Co-operativesJ. Roberts6181
12Sellers InternationalA. Exley1180

Prizes:

1st: £200
2nd: £100
3rd: £ 75

Qualifiers:
Black Dyke, Yorkshire Building Society, Brighouse & Rastrick
Brighouse qualify from 2000 Championships
